Gurugram: MSM Unify, a leading global education company and part of Laul Global, has announced the appointment of Nikhil Sharda as Assistant Vice President – Brand & Marketing.
With over two decades of experience across brand strategy, digital transformation, creative communications and integrated marketing, Sharda brings a strong blend of strategic thinking and creative leadership to MSM Unify. In his new role, he will oversee brand design, lead all marketing and digital operations including performance marketing and employer branding, and manage global communication strategies. His mandate includes strengthening MSM Unify’s positioning as a trusted partner for international education consultants and educational institutions worldwide.
Prior to joining MSM Unify, Sharda served as AVP at The Marcom Avenue, where he led multiple marketing campaigns, B2B development initiatives, brand perception programs and end-to-end communication mandates across sectors. His earlier stints include roles at FrogIdeas (now Renaissance), Media Mantra, Scroll Mantra and AGL – Hakuhodo, where he was instrumental in driving digital strategy, brand positioning and integrated marketing solutions.
